HPE Morpheus Enterprise Software Administration
H45ZDS
Table of Contents
Overview
This is course is an introduction to the HPE Morpheus Enterprise Software platform. It includes instructor-led and hands-on labs that walk you through how to manage the most used HPE Morpheus Enterprise features, such as the foundations of platform management, creating instance types and blueprints, configuring and backing up the appliance, monitoring, and self-service. During the class, you are granted access to a single-node HPE Morpheus Enterprise appliance to follow along with the instructor through multiple labs.
Audience
This course is ideal for IT administrators, platform architects, and solutions architects.
Prerequisites
There are no prerequisites, but we recommend that you have a general understanding of Linux administration, cloud concepts, and IT concepts before taking this course.
Objectives
After completing this course, you should be able to:
- Identify and describe deployable architectures
- Understand the installation process
- Perform initial systems configurations
- Understand automation concepts like inputs, option lists, task, workflows, code repositories, script, and file templates
- Explain RBAC capabilities such as policies, roles, and user management
- Explain infrastructure concepts like groups, clouds, and cypher
Certifications and related exams
This course prepares you for the HPE Morpheus Enterprise Software Certified Administrator exam, a requirement for earning the HPE Advanced Product Certified – HPE Morpheus Enterprise Software Administrator certification.
